Sniper: The White Raven (2022) arrives like a late-night transmission from the underside of geopolitics: tight, cold, and humming with the patience of a hunter. The film straps you into a sniper’s world where silence is the primary language and every decision is measured in millimeters and heartbeats. The White Raven trades blockbuster spectacle for a different kind of tension. It’s a study in isolation: a lone marksman, long lenses, and an environment that can be as deadly as the human antagonists he faces. The film’s mood is minimalist but meticulous. Cinematography favors long, patient takes and a narrowed field of vision that mimics the scope’s tunnel: the world outside that circle is blurred into ambiguity, rumor, and threat. That visual choice turns viewers into complicit observers, forcing us to listen for meaning in small sounds — a twig snapping, the hiss of breath, the distant echo of a vehicle.
Story-wise, Sniper: The White Raven layers personal stakes onto a mission’s cold calculus. The “White Raven” itself functions on multiple levels: an operational codename, an omen of rarity, and a mirror for the protagonist’s own solitude. The plot tightens around tradecraft — reconnaissance, stalking, the setup and execution of a shot — but the emotional core keeps the film from becoming merely procedural. Flashed memories, terse exchanges, and the occasional moral hesitation remind us that the person behind the rifle carries a history that affects aim, timing, and target selection.
The film’s pacing is its quiet power. Scenes stretch to let suspense accumulate naturally; when action breaks out, it’s precise and consequential. Sound design is especially effective — ambient noises and the exaggerated intimacy of silence create a soundscape where small things scream. The score rarely intrudes, opting instead to let tension rise from environment and performance.
Performances are measured and interior. The lead crafts a portrait of someone practiced in restraint: controlled movements, economy of dialogue, and a gaze that catalogs the world in tactical terms. Supporting characters flicker in and out like waypoints — allies, informants, adversaries — each revealing a facet of the protagonist’s past or the geopolitical tangle that provided the mission’s backdrop.

Sniper: The White Raven (2022) is a gritty Ukrainian war drama based on the real-life story of Mykola Voronin, a former physics teacher turned marksman. Set during the early stages of the conflict in Donbas in 2014, the film follows Mykola’s transformation from a pacifist living off-the-grid into an elite sniper after a brutal encounter with invading soldiers claims the life of his pregnant wife. Protagonist: Mykola (played by Pavlo Aldoshyn), a quirky idealist who teaches physics and lives in an eco-friendly "dugout" with his wife, Nastya.
The Catalyst: After Russian-backed militants murder his wife and burn their home, a grief-stricken Mykola enlists in a volunteer battalion.

The film has been praised for its tactical realism and evocative cinematography, holding a 78% approval rating on Rotten Tomatoes .
Authenticity: Co-written by the real Mykola Voronin, the production featured nearly 100 actual members of the Ukrainian Armed Forces and National Guard.
